Community Action Team grants
Community Action Team (CAT) grants are inspired and led by employees who are partnering with qualified charitable organizations to identify community needs and then plan, organize and participate in responsive volunteer events. These grants are reviewed by an employee council and, if approved, sponsored by the Foundation. Nonprofits can be recipients of this grant type by engaging a team of at least four salesforce.com employees and reminding them to take advantage of the CAT grant incentive program.
Dollars for Doers
Salesforce.com employees who have volunteered a minimum of 10 hours with an eligible nonprofit in any given year are qualified for a grant. For every 10 hours volunteered, the Foundation will donate $100, with an annual donation cap of $500 per employee, per nonprofit.
Matching gifts
Employees donating funds to qualified nonprofit organizations are eligible for matching funds from the Foundation—up to $1,000 per employee, per calendar year. Salesforce.com employees should submit their requests early to take advantage of this program.
